Robust Metal Siding for Storage Sheds

Metal siding gives a multitude of perks when it comes to safeguarding your storage shed. Firstly, metal is incredibly strong, able to withstand the rigors of weather conditions like rain, snow, and wind with ease. This shielding ensures your belongings remain secure from the elements. Secondly, metal siding is known for its reduced maintenance requirements. Unlike wood siding, it prevents rot, warping, and insect infestations, saving you time and money on upkeep. Additionally, a metal finish can add a modern look to your shed, enhancing the overall curb value.

Picking the Best Metal Siding for Your Shed

When erecting a shed, metal siding is a robust option that can withstand the elements and increase your structure's curb appeal. But with so many different types of metal siding available, selecting the right one for your needs can be tricky.

Think about factors like your budget, climate, and personal style when selecting a siding material. Popular options include aluminum, steel, and copper, each with its own unique benefits. Aluminum is lightweight and corrosion-resistant, while steel is tough and can be finished in a variety of colors. Copper offers a classic look but needs more upkeep.
